THE LEWIS SEWELL MEMORIAL TRUST 

We are a small grant making charitable trust. We welcome applications from young people for grants that fulfil our charitable purpose:To advance in life and relieve needs by making grants to persons aged 25 and under that will develop their skills, capacities and capabilities in the performing arts and enable them to participate in society as mature and responsible individuals.
